
Krzysio worked across google/android-cuttlefish, google/swiftshader, tensorflow/tensorflow, and google/perfetto, focusing on build stability, code maintainability, and compatibility. He standardized ABSL dependencies in the WebRTC module to reduce drift and improve future updates, using C++ and build system configuration. In SwiftShader and TensorFlow, he addressed Android build compatibility by refining compiler flags and refactored file system logic to streamline temporary file handling. For Perfetto, Krzysio resolved Protobuf compatibility issues and improved error reporting by updating protozero error handling and correcting log formatting. His work demonstrated depth in dependency management, error handling, and cross-repository code refactoring.

Sep 2025 monthly summary for google/perfetto: focusing on reliability and compatibility improvements in error reporting and warning formatting. Key deliverables include two bug fixes with Protobuf compatibility and warning display improvements. 1) Protobuf error reporting updated to support Protobuf 4.22.0+ via protozero (commit a4b79df15fe98054ce7ec5ac954c81253db7a253). 2) Fixed formatting string in filter_util.cc to correctly display warnings (commit e73cf6849f98992bf7df88d29de1568aa882b16a). Major bugs fixed: these two. Overall impact: increased stability of error reporting across Protobuf version updates, improved log readability and observability, reduced user-visible issues. Technologies/skills demonstrated: C++, protozero, Protobuf, logging utilities, formatting, patch management.
Sep 2025 monthly summary for google/perfetto: focusing on reliability and compatibility improvements in error reporting and warning formatting. Key deliverables include two bug fixes with Protobuf compatibility and warning display improvements. 1) Protobuf error reporting updated to support Protobuf 4.22.0+ via protozero (commit a4b79df15fe98054ce7ec5ac954c81253db7a253). 2) Fixed formatting string in filter_util.cc to correctly display warnings (commit e73cf6849f98992bf7df88d29de1568aa882b16a). Major bugs fixed: these two. Overall impact: increased stability of error reporting across Protobuf version updates, improved log readability and observability, reduced user-visible issues. Technologies/skills demonstrated: C++, protozero, Protobuf, logging utilities, formatting, patch management.
July 2025 Summary: Strengthened build stability and code clarity across two major repos (google/swiftshader and tensorflow/tensorflow). Delivered targeted changes to reduce future maintenance burden and improve cross-platform compatibility, while preserving functionality across Android and CPU-based workflows.
July 2025 Summary: Strengthened build stability and code clarity across two major repos (google/swiftshader and tensorflow/tensorflow). Delivered targeted changes to reduce future maintenance burden and improve cross-platform compatibility, while preserving functionality across Android and CPU-based workflows.
Month 2024-11: Focused on stabilizing WebRTC build dependencies in google/android-cuttlefish by aligning ABSL usage with the canonical copy. This standardization reduces dependency drift, improves build stability and maintainability, and paves the way for smoother future updates across the WebRTC module.
Month 2024-11: Focused on stabilizing WebRTC build dependencies in google/android-cuttlefish by aligning ABSL usage with the canonical copy. This standardization reduces dependency drift, improves build stability and maintainability, and paves the way for smoother future updates across the WebRTC module.
Overview of all repositories you've contributed to across your timeline